West Jakarta Administration will hold the Glodok Chinatown Night Culinary event along Jalan Pancoran, Glodok Urban Village, Taman Sari Sub-district, on Saturday (6/20).
The event will take place from 2 PM until about 11 PM
Taman Sari Sub-district Head Simson Hutagalung explained that the event, which is part of Jakarta's 499th anniversary celebrations, will also feature a variety of attractions.
He detailed that the event will showcase 60 MSMEs offering Glodok and Betawi culinary specialties. Alongside local street food vendors, the administration has also opened slots for entrepreneurs fostered by the West Jakarta MSME Sub-agency and selected Jakpreneur participants from several urban villages.
"A total of 60 MSMEs will be accommodated in tents set up along the northern side of Jalan Pancoran," he said on Monday (6/15).
Simson said the administration is working with corporate social responsibility (CSR) partners to provide tables and chairs along the sidewalk for visitors attending the night culinary event.
According to him, visitors can enjoy a variety of halal and non-halal dishes, with cashless transactions supported through a QRIS payment system provided by Bank Jakarta.
"The event will take place from 2 PM until about 11 PM, and traffic diversions will be in effect in the surrounding area," he noted.
